Edit an Existing Medication
A Patient’s medication record can be edited in one of three ways, depending on the reason for modification. To edit an existing medication record, click the Medication link and select from the list of options Edit, Change, or Discontinue.
Select… |
To/If… |
---|---|
Edit |
Fix errors made when initially entering the medication. |
Change |
Apply any changes made to an existing prescription based on the Physician’s order. For example, increase or decrease the Amount or Frequency. |
Discontinue |
The Physician has ordered the Patient to stop taking the medication. The Discontinue Order Date field is the date taken to create an Interim Order for the discontinuation. Select the Create an Interim Order for the Medication Discontinuation checkbox to open the required Cert. Period field. The Certification Period is automatically selected to reflect the date when the medication was ordered to discontinue. |
